Skinny & Spiced Jalapeno Poppers

Pin It

Ingredients

  • 8 small jalapenos, seeded and cut in ½ lengthwise
  • ½ cup part-skim shredded cheddar cheese

  • ¼ cup reduced-fat cream cheese (about ½ a stick)

  • 1 tbsp. reduced fat mayonnaise
  • 2 tsp. chili powder
  • 1 tsp. cumin
  • 1 egg, beaten

  • 1 cup Cornflakes, crumbled

Directions

Preheat oven to 350*

Coat your baking sheet with cooking spray. In a medium bowl, soften your cream cheese at 10 second increments 2 should do it] in the microwave. Once soft enough to stir, add in shredded cheese, mayonnaise, cumin, and chili powder. Mix well and set aside.

Cut peppers in half (lengthwise) and remove seeds. Fill peppers with cheese mixture.
 In a shallow dish, beat 1 egg. In a 2nd shallow dish, crumble corn flakes. Dip peppers individually in egg then roll it in the cornflake crumbles to coat. Transfer peppers to lightly-greased baking sheet and coat again with cooking spray. 
Bake at 350* for 25-30 minutes, until filling is heated through (will bubble) and the outside begins to brown.
